Major Urban Infrastructure Challenges
1. Transportation Congestion
One of the most common problems in growing cities is traffic congestion.
As populations increase, more people rely on cars and public transportation systems, which can overwhelm existing infrastructure.
Problems caused by traffic congestion include:
- longer commuting times
- increased fuel consumption
- air pollution
- reduced productivity
Cities must invest in modern transportation solutions such as metro systems, smart traffic management, and public transit expansion.
2. Housing Shortages
Rapid urbanization often leads to housing shortages and rising property prices.
Many growing cities struggle to provide affordable housing for their expanding populations.
This can result in:
- overcrowded housing
- informal settlements
- rising living costs
- social inequality
Urban planners must develop sustainable housing solutions and efficient land-use planning.
3. Water Supply and Sanitation
Providing clean water and proper sanitation is another major challenge in growing cities.
As populations increase, water demand rises dramatically.
Challenges include:
- aging water infrastructure
- water scarcity
- pollution of water sources
- inefficient distribution systems
Investing in modern water treatment facilities and smart water management systems can help address these issues.
4. Energy Demand and Power Infrastructure
Growing cities require large amounts of electricity to power homes, businesses, and transportation systems.
Rapid urban growth can strain existing power grids, leading to:
- power outages
- increased energy costs
- environmental pollution
Cities are increasingly adopting renewable energy systems and smart grid technologies to improve energy efficiency.
5. Waste Management Problems
Urban populations generate enormous amounts of waste every day.
Without effective waste management systems, cities may experience:
- environmental pollution
- landfill overflow
- public health risks
Modern cities are exploring solutions such as:
- recycling programs
- waste-to-energy technologies
- smart waste collection systems
Smart Infrastructure Solutions for Growing Cities
To address these challenges, many cities are investing in smart infrastructure technologies.
Smart infrastructure uses digital technologies such as:
- sensors
- data analytics
- artificial intelligence
- Internet of Things (IoT)
These technologies help city planners monitor infrastructure systems in real time and optimize their performance.
Examples include:
- smart traffic lights that reduce congestion
- intelligent energy grids
- automated water management systems
